Marvel’s Spider-Man 2is one of the most anticipated PS5 games and the game’s first trailer got us even more hyped by giving us our first look at Venom, who we learned would be voiced by veteran actor Tony Todd.

The originalMarvel’s Spider-Manwas released back in 2018 and broke all sorts of sales records for a PlayStation exclusive, which was followed up last year with the very successfulMarvel’s Spider-Man Miles Morales.

Insomniac Games had let it be known that they were working on the full sequelSpider-Man 2and today’s PlayStation Showcase gave us that very first trailer that introduced a horror film icon as the fan-favorite Venom.

Marvel’s Spider-Man 2Trailer Information

The first trailer forMarvel’s Spider-Man 2was full of hype, as we see both Peter Parker and Miles Morales fighting bad guys while being narrated by who seems to be Kraven the Hunter.

For anyone that has played the first game and Miles Morales, it was all but a certainty that Venom would also be brought into the mix, which happens at the end of the trailer.

Based on the first game, it would seem that Venom will be Harry Osborn instead of Eddie Brock, but it’s always possible that could be a fakeout. We have no way of knowing for sure at this point, because we only saw Venom himself with the menacing voice of Tony Todd behind it.

Who isSpider-Man 2’sVenom, Tony Todd?

There is a very good chance that you’ve heard Tony Todd’s voice in something over the years, while also not actually knowing what his name was. That is because he has been known for his fantastic voice above anything else, even though he has his fair share of on-screen roles as well.

He made his film debut back in 1986 as Sgt. Warren in Platoon and has been a very prolific actor ever since. Todd currently has 239 actor credits on IMDB, where he is most well known for playing The Candyman in theCandymanfilms. This includes his return as the character in the new film that just came out a couple of weeks ago as well.

Todd has had plenty of on-screen television roles as well, including shows likeStar Trek,Chuck, and more. One of the most recognizable in recent years might be his voice-only role as Zoom in the second season ofThe Flasha few years ago.

Needless to say, there have been plenty of roles that you may have at least heard Todd in over the years. When trying to think of people to voice Venom in Marvel’s Spider-Man 2, Insomniac could not have gotten any better than Tony Todd.
